A global insurance business is recruiting for a newly created Deputy Treasurer position that is crucial to supporting senior leadership with strategic initiatives. The role involves managing long-term cash forecasting, contributing to corporate finance projects, and enhancing treasury operations. This is an essential position for the clients growth, especially as they actively pursue mergers and acquisitions (M&A) strategies. The Deputy Treasurer is expected to lead the development of comprehensive 12-month rolling cash flow forecasts across various regions and facilitate weekly cash reporting to optimize business cash collections and manage client payment terms.
The position requires delivering monthly reporting, which includes reconciling financial models and conducting variance analysis. The Deputy Treasurer will be tasked with supporting reporting needs for external stakeholders like lenders and investors, and overseeing working capital reporting with a focus on understanding DSO/DPO impacts. Additionally, the role involves selecting and implementing a Treasury Management System within the first year. The Deputy Treasurer will support debt origination and management activities, including lender engagement, due diligence, and ensuring covenant compliance, while also identifying opportunities to improve banking, collections, payments, and working capital processes.
Candidates should have a professional qualification in Accounting or Treasury and experience with Adaptive Planning, particularly for treasury and cash flow modeling. A minimum of ten years progressive experience in finance or treasury roles is required, alongside hands-on experience implementing a Treasury Management System. The successful candidate should thrive in a fast-paced, private equity-backed environment and possess strong presentation, communication, and stakeholder management skills.
Experience in managing teams, especially those offshore or remote, will be crucial, as will the willingness to undertake occasional international travel.
